Title: | Grave Stone Fragment | |
Category: | Inscriptions | |
Description: | Inscribed fragment of grave stone. Roughly picked top preserved; otherwise broken all around. A moulding broken away above the inscription. One line of the inscription preserved. Hymettian marble. ADDENDA Joins with I 4297. | |
Context: | Found in the wall of the modern house 639/19, at the north foot of the Areopagus. | |
